First off, let's talk about what optical bonding is. In simple terms, optical bonding is a process where a layer of adhesive is used to bond a cover glass or another optical element directly to a display panel. This might sound like a small thing, but it can have a huge impact on the performance of the display.
One of the main ways optical bonding improves display clarity is by reducing reflections. When you have an ordinary display, there are multiple air - glass interfaces. Each of these interfaces can cause light to reflect, which leads to glare and reduces the contrast of the image. You've probably experienced this when trying to look at your phone screen on a sunny day or when a computer monitor has a lot of reflections from overhead lights.


With optical bonding, the adhesive fills in the gap between the cover glass and the display panel, eliminating the air - glass interface. This significantly reduces the amount of reflected light. As a result, the display looks clearer, and you can see the content more easily, even in bright environments. For example, in outdoor digital signage, where sunlight can be extremely bright, optical bonding can make a world of difference. The signs become more visible, and the colors appear more vivid.
Another aspect is the improvement in contrast. Contrast is the difference between the brightest whites and the darkest blacks on a display. A higher contrast ratio means that the colors are more vibrant and the details are more distinct. In a non - optically bonded display, reflections can wash out the blacks and make the overall image look dull. By reducing reflections, optical bonding allows the display to show true blacks and bright whites, which enhances the contrast. This is particularly important in applications like medical displays, where accurate color representation and high contrast are crucial for doctors to read medical images correctly.
Let's also consider the viewing angle. In a normal display, the image quality can degrade as you view the screen from an angle. The colors might shift, and the brightness can decrease. Optical bonding helps to improve the viewing angle performance. The adhesive layer helps to maintain the integrity of the light path, so the image looks more consistent no matter where you're looking at it from. This is great for public displays or large - format monitors in offices, where people might be viewing the screen from different positions.
Now, I want to mention some real - world examples. Take automotive displays, for instance. As cars become more high - tech, the displays inside are becoming larger and more important. Drivers need to be able to see the information clearly, whether it's the speedometer, navigation, or entertainment system. Optical bonding reduces glare from sunlight and improves the clarity of the display, which is not only convenient but also a safety feature.
In the industrial sector, machinery often has displays that are used in harsh environments. These displays are exposed to dust, moisture, and vibrations. Optical bonding not only improves the clarity but also protects the display. The bonded cover glass acts as an extra layer of protection, preventing dust and moisture from getting between the cover glass and the display panel, which could otherwise cause damage and reduce clarity over time.
